The family migration program has  been around since the Immigration and Nationality Act of 1965 and allows U.S. citizens and lawful permanent residents to bring in their immediate relatives to the U.S. This law did away with the racially discriminatory national origins quota system from the 1920s. Palm Beach, FL  – On Monday, about five hundred Haitian-American protesters and allies protested outside of Trump’s Mar-a-Lago resort in Florida, where the President was staying for the holiday weekend.
